Output 576971a04aa90f65187248453cd0024829e923f049c0062ac80b089832cbf00a:0

value
15933721
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f6459548425fe8a6af14ceaeccb8471073fb29 OP_EQUALVERIFY OP_CHECKSIG
address
14NSMAvpwLp9UTr9Cx3CkiWddmWdqecqCC
transaction
576971a04aa90f65187248453cd0024829e923f049c0062ac80b089832cbf00a
spent
true